❏
In Home Mode, select
Magazine
,
Newspaper
, or
Text/Line Art
as the Document
Type. Then select
Black&White
or
Color
as the Image Type, and choose
Printer
or
Other
as your Destination setting. Preview and select your scan area as
described in "Previewing and Adjusting the Scan Area" on page 29. Then click
Scan
. Your document is scanned, processed into editable text, and opened in the
FineReader window.
❏
In Professional Mode, select
Reflective
as the Document Type,
Document Table
as the Document Source, and
Document
as the Auto Exposure Type. Then select
Black&White
,
24-bit Color
, or
48-bit Color
as the Image Type, and
300
dpi as the
Resolution. Preview and select your scan area as described in "Previewing and
Adjusting the Scan Area" on page 29. Then click
Scan
. Your document is scanned,
processed into editable text, and opened in the FineReader window.
Note:
In Home or Professional Mode, if the characters in your text are not recognized very well, you
can improve recognition by adjusting the
Threshold
setting. See "Adjusting the Color and
Other Image Settings" on page 34 for instructions.
4. Follow the instructions in ABBYY FineReader Help to edit and save your document.
